Should you refrigerate buns?

Properly stored, hamburger buns will last for about 5 to 7 days at normal room temperature. In extremely warm, humid temperatures, hamburger buns should be frozen for longer-term storage. … Hamburger buns should ideally not be refrigerated, as they will dry out and become stale faster than storage at room temperature.

How do you keep your buns soft after baking?

Immediately after baking, whilst still hot, brush a bit of butter on the buns, then cover with a kitchen towel to retain moisture and keep them soft.

How do you store bread and rolls general storage?

In general, bread and rolls are best stored at room temperature. The refrigerator is not a good place to keep bread. Especially bread containing rye flour quickly turns stale at lower temperatures.

How do you make bread stay soft longer?

Add sugar to soften the crumb

With the addition of sugar, the bread will be softer and keep soft for longer. For quickly made bread, sugar is also useful to provide food for the yeast.

How do you make bread more moist after baking?

You need two things to revive stale bread: moisture and heat. Misting the crust lightly with water, wrapping the loaf in foil, and baking at 375 degrees for 10 minutes delivered both of these key elements and made my four-day-old bread taste relatively fresh.

Why is my bread hard after cooling?

A thick and hard crust on your bread is primarily caused by overbaking or baking in a temperature that’s too high. Make sure that you adjust the temperature of your oven to suit the type of bread that you’re making.

What is the best way to store homemade bread?

Bread storage takeaways

Store airtight with the two cut halves facing each other and pressed together. Wrapping bread to retain moisture keeps it soft, though it robs crusty artisan bread of its crispy crust. Wrapping in plastic (or foil) rather than cloth keeps bread soft longer.
